Who Do We Serve at Our Treatment Center?
Our 24-bed treatment facility in Fort Worth offers a comfortable and home-like environment for teen girls ages 13–18. We help patients who are dealing with eating disorders, mild to moderate substance abuse, and mental health concerns.

Substance Abuse
Substance abuse refers to using illegal drugs, prescription or over-the-counter medications, or alcohol for purposes other than their intended use. Substances that overload reward circuits can rewire teenagers’ brains.
Our residential treatment center focuses on helping teens who are dealing with substance abuse related to vaping or mild alcohol or marijuana use. We offer both SMART Recovery and 12-Step options to help your teen reach sobriety.
Mental Health Concerns
Common mental health disorders in the teen years include depression, anxiety, and bipolar disorder. Depression causes low mood, hopelessness, and a lack of interest in previous hobbies, while anxiety results in worry, fear, and nervousness. Bipolar disorder involves mood swings, often alternating between mania and depression. Services at Our Treatment Center
Our live-in recovery facility in Fort Worth offers twice-weekly therapy and dietician meetings, weekly psychiatry and family therapy, and a weekly substance abuse support group as needed.
Therapy
Our providers specialize in c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), dialectical behavior therapy (DBT), family-based therapy (FBT), and acceptance and commitment therapy (ACT). These evidence-based modalities help our patients develop coping skills as they make their way through life’s challenges.
Psychiatry
Our psychiatrist is board-certified in child and adolescent psychiatry and specializes in treating eating disorders. Weekly sessions with our psychiatrist help ensure your teen is supported and any medication she may be taking is managed by a professional.
Dietary Support
Our dieticians and eating disorder specialists help patients with meal planning and provide support with eating challenges through exposure therapy. We are here to uplift your teen on her journey to a healthy relationship with food.
Family Therapy
Our team will work with your teen’s entire family through therapy and education. This collaborative approach helps foster long-lasting healing at home and in daily life.
Substance Abuse Support Group
Our substance abuse support group runs as needed and allows patients to form a community, develop coping skills, and support one another’s recovery.
Additional Offerings
We also offer equine therapy, mindfulness and yoga groups, art therapy, music therapy, narrative therapy, and motivational interviewing, all to help patients rediscover their strength and confidence.
